          DIGEST

          1. Protest that Department of Defense agency improperly permitted Federal Prison
          Industries, Inc. (FPI) to participate in an Historically Underutilized Business Zone
          (HUBZone) small business set-aside procurement for supplies on the FPI Schedule,
          is denied where statute and regulations specifically allow FPI to participate in the
          procurement.

          2. Protest that agency improperly failed to apply HUBZone price evaluation
          preference is denied where the solicitation did not include the price evaluation
          preference.
          DECISION

          Tennier Industries, Inc., of Boca Raton, Florida, protests the Defense Logistics
          Agency's award of a contract to Federal Prison Industries, Inc. (FPI), of Washington,
          D.C., under request for proposals (RFP) No. SPM1C1-09-R-0081, for extreme
          cold/wet weather trousers. The RFP was set aside for historically underutilized
          business zone (HUBZone) small business concerns. Tennier contends that the
          award to FPI is improper because FPI is not a HUBZone small business and will not
          provide a product manufactured by a HUBZone small business as required by the
          solicitation.


We deny the protest.
